KTEX-106 RANKED NUMBER ONE IN SPRING 2025 NIELSEN RATINGS
Radio station KTTX, known as KTEX 106, is celebrating the latest Nielsen Company ratings for the Bryan/College Station area.

In the most recent Nielsen Radio Spring 2025 Bryan/College Station Total Survey Area ratings, KTEX 106 is the number one overall station in the important Adults 25-54 demographic, based on average rating and share Monday through Sunday 6 a.m. to midnight. The Bryan/College Station TSA includes Brazos, Burleson, Milam, Robertson, Madison and Leon counties. Also, among adults 25-54, the KTEX morning show of Eilish and Cowboy Dave was ranked #1 in the Monday through Friday 6 to 10 a.m. time period based on average rating and share. The KTEX midday show with Courtney Cartwright was also ranked #1 in the 10 a.m. to 3 p.m. time period. And the evening show with Craig Montana was ranked #1 7 p.m. to midnight among the adult 25-54 listening audience.
Station President Tom Whitehead says KTEX’s great ratings are a credit to the hard work General Manager Shannan Canales and her staff have put into serving the communities in the area. Whitehead says the fact that these ratings don’t even include KTEX’s home county of Washington, or the neighboring counties of Austin, Lee, Fayette, Grimes and Waller, really shows the popularity of the station in the region.

The Nielsen Radio Spring Audio Survey was conducted April 3rd through June 25th of this year.
